Adds entries to or removes entries from a cache group.
|
BOOL SetUrlCacheEntryGroup(
LPCTSTR lpszUrlName,
DWORD dwFlags,
GROUPID GroupId,
LPBYTE pbGroupAttributes,
DWORD cbGroupAttributes,
LPVOID lpReserved
); |
Parameters
- lpszUrlName
- [in] Pointer to a null-terminated string value that specifies the URL of the cached resource.
- dwFlags
- [in] Determines whether the entry is added to or removed from a cache group. This parameter can be one of the following values.
| Value | Meaning |
| INTERNET_CACHE_GROUP_ADD | Adds the cache entry to the cache group. |
| INTERNET_CACHE_GROUP_REMOVE | Removes the entry from the cache |
- GroupId
- [in] Identifier of the cache group that the entry will be added to or removed from.
- pbGroupAttributes
- [in] Reserved. Must be NULL.
- cbGroupAttributes
- [in] Reserved. Must be zero.
- lpReserved
- [in] Reserved. Must be NULL.
Return Values
Returns TRUE if successful, or FALSE otherwise.
Remarks
A cache entry can belong to more than one cache group.
Requirements
OS Versions: Windows CE 2.12 and later.
Header: Wininet.h.
Link Library: Wininet.lib.
